In honor of the release of BARBARA FOREVER, an expansive new documentary about pioneering artist and filmmaker Barbara Hammer, the Music Box presents nine short films from throughout her rich career. Screening on 16mm with special thanks to Canyon Cinema. 


Schizy (1968) - 4 min - 16mm

Women's Rites or Truth is the Daughter of Time (1974) - 8 min - 16mm

Multiple Orgasm (1977) - 6 min  - 16mm

Sync Touch (1981) - 12 min - 16mm

See What You Hear What You See (1983) - 3 min - 16mm

No No Nooky TV (1987) - 12 min - 16mm

Place Mattes (1987) - 8 min - 16mm

Still Point (1989) - 8 min - 16mm

Vital Signs (1991) - 9 min - 16mm
